WCJ_Module D

Total Complexity 192
Dependencies 2
Dependents 0
Total lines 1,075
Lines of code 607
Logical lines of code 305
Comment lines 409
Methods 44
Properties 10

Methods 44

Method Rating Maintainability Complexity Lines of code
create_meta_box()
D
30 36 97
save_meta_box()
B
45 17 34
maybe_fix_settings()
A
50 16 26
add_enable_module_setting()
A
45 10 40
reset_settings()
A
54 11 17
save_meta_box_validate_value()
S
51 6 25
save_meta_box_value()
S
51 6 25
__construct()
S
51 5 25
add_module_tools_info_to_tools_dashboard()
S
53 5 21
handle_deprecated_options()
S
58 5 16
admin_notices()
S
62 6 10
get_cat_by_section()
S
60 5 12
add_meta_box()
S
60 4 13
add_tools()
S
59 4 12
add_module_tools_tabs()
S
62 3 12
add_reset_settings_button()
S
52 2 24
add_standard_settings()
S
66 3 8
handle_price()
S
69 3 6
get_extra_desc()
S
67 3 9
get_desc()
S
67 3 9
add_tool_link()
S
62 3 10
validate_value_admin_notices()
S
61 2 12
setup_default_autoload()
S
63 2 12
add_tools_list()
S
55 1 22
get_tool_header_html()
S
63 2 9
remove_wpml_hooks()
S
69 2 6
settings_section()
S
75 2 4
is_enabled()
S
78 2 3
remove_wpml_functions_before_get_terms()
S
70 2 6
restore_wpml_args_on_get_products()
S
69 2 6
add_wpml_args_on_get_products()
S
69 2 6
restore_wpml_functions_after_get_terms()
S
70 2 6
add_settings_from_file()
S
70 2 5
get_meta_box_options()
S
73 2 4
handle_hide_on_free_parameter()
S
68 2 7
get_settings()
S
70 1 6
get_back_to_settings_link_html()
S
70 1 5
add_notice_query_var()
S
73 1 4
suppress_filters()
S
80 1 3
add_settings()
S
78 1 3
get_wpml_terms_in_all_languages_setting()
S
63 1 10
validate_value_add_notice_query_var()
S
73 1 4
get_wpml_products_in_all_languages_setting()
S
63 1 10
get_deprecated_options()
S
82 1 3